gemini i says:VCSY Time Priority IP refers to the intellectual property (IP) held by Vertical Computer Systems, Inc. (VCSY), specifically related to their time and attendance tracking software application called PTS™. This application is being developed by their subsidiary, Priority Time Systems, Inc.

While detailed public information about the specific patents or intellectual property within VCSY Time Priority IP is limited, here's what we can gather based on available information:

PTS™ Application: This time and attendance software aims to help organizations track employee hours, manage schedules, and automate payroll processes. It likely includes features for clocking in/out, leave management, overtime calculations, and reporting.
Focus on Efficiency and Automation: The software probably aims to streamline time tracking and reduce manual processes for improved efficiency and accuracy.
Integration with Payroll and HR Systems: It may offer integration with other payroll and HR systems to facilitate seamless data flow and reduce administrative overhead.1
